    Ever since a leaked image showed off dual cameras on HTC's next One (aka the M8), the rumor mill has been trying to figure out what they're for, exactly. Now, an ad leaked to GSM Arena from Australian carrier Telstra appears to have removed all mystery. First off, the phone is referred to as the "All New HTC One (M8)," likely to distinguish it from the last model. As for the "Duo Camera," it'll bring improved low-light capabilities and let you select the focus of a shot after it's been taken -- as predicted. You'll also be able to highlight significant areas of a shot, soften the background and add 3D effects. Another big reveal is the 5-inch, full HD, scratch-resistant screen (a step up from the last One's 4.7-inch display), along with dual "BoomSound" speakers. Finally, the latest Sense 6.0 version will let you double tap the screen to turn on the phone and swipe to access apps and social info.     While we're still scratching around with Ultrapixels and OIS, scientists in Singapore claim they're working on something that could change the entire field of photography. Researchers at the Nanyang Technological University have developed an image sensor made out of graphene that's 1,000 times better at capturing light than traditional CMOS or CCD sensors, all while using 10x less energy. These new sensors may initially be used in surveillance equipment and satellites -- when they do eventually end up in regular cameras, however, they're promised to be five times cheaper than the sensors they're replacing.     We've been watching out for the D600 since images leaked a couple of months ago, and today it's been made official: a full-frame DSLR that's priced ever-so-slightly closer to the reach of mortals (read: "high-end enthusiasts") who perhaps can't claim everything off their tax. At just shy of $2,100 (update: €2,150 in Europe), the 24-megapixel camera's US list price is significantly lower than that of the 36-megapixel D800, and undercuts Canon's rival EOS 5D Mark III and Sony's brand new full-frame Alpha A99. What's more, aside from the resolution, you're getting something pretty close to the D800 -- including a weather- and dust-resistant magnesium alloy build, fast Exspeed III processor, and AF that works down to f/8 -- but here it's all contained in a body that sheds a full 15 percent off the D800's weight. It feels great to hold a full-frame DSLR like this, which is barely any heavier or more conspicuous than an APS-C shooter like the D7000. Nikon is also making a big deal out of the fact that the D600 handles wireless transfers and triggers using the new WU-1b widget, which is identical to the familiar WU-1a we reviewed on the D3200 except that it plugs into the camera's USB port rather than the HDMI port. There's an Android app to allow your mobile device to communicate with the camera, and an iOS app is set to land by the end of September.     Nikon faced some backlash following the announcement of its D800 DSLR, due both to the camera's potentially excessive 36.3-megapixel resolution and its relatively limited top sensitivity of ISO 25,600. Then, less than one month later, Canon revealed its own mid-range full-frame cam -- the 5D Mark III -- with a 22.3-megapixel sensor, and an option to shoot at ISO 102,400. Both models appeal to the same market of professional photographers, but with vastly different specs, which is the better pick? Low-light shooters will likely base part of that decision on high-ISO capabilities, and after reviewing samples from both cameras, there appears to be a winner.DPReview spent some time with the D800, and we took the Canon for a spin last week. We scaled the D800 sample down to 22.3 megapixels to match the 5D, then pasted a 300-by-400 1:1 pixel section from each camera side-by-side in the image above. The D800 JPEG (on the left) appears to be the noisier of the two, which seems logical, considering that Nikon opted to boost the camera's resolution instead of its sensitivity. Still, the cam's top-ISO is quite usable, and if you plan to shoot in a studio setting or can live without a six-digit sensitivity, the D800 will likely suit you just fine.     With mirrorless cameras offering high-resolution APS-C sensors and consecutive shooting speeds of up to 10 frames-per-second, what's left to make a $6,000 full-frame DSLR a compelling purchase, especially for amateur photographers? Low-light performance, for one -- the Canon EOS-1D X and Nikon D4 are both capable of capturing images at up to ISO 204,800, letting you snap sharp photos in even the dimmest of lighting conditions. The benefits of a top sensitivity of ISO 204,800 are significant -- jumping from one ISO to the next doubles your shutter speed. So an exposure of f/2.8 at 1/2 second at ISO 400 becomes 1/4th at ISO 800, 1/15th at ISO 3200, 1/60th at ISO 12,800, 1/250th at ISO 51,200 and a whopping 1/1000th at ISO 204,800 -- fast enough to freeze a speeding car.Both Canon and Nikon have yet to allow us to take away samples shot with the 1D X or D4 -- the companies even taped CF card slots shut to prevent show attendees from slipping their own card in -- but we were still able to get a fairly good idea of high-ISO performance from reviewing images on the built-in LCDs. At the cameras' top sensitivity of ISO 204,800, noise was visible even during a full image preview. Zooming into the image revealed significant noise, as expected. However, within each camera's native range of ISO 100 to 25,600, noise was barely an issue at all. Both cameras are still pre-production samples at this point, so we'll need to wait for production models to make their way out before we can capture our own samples, but based on what we saw when reviewing ISO 204,800 images on the built-in LCDs, that incredible top-ISO setting may actually be usable.     Of all the new Nikons announced today, the P310 is likely to be one of the most popular. Its 4.2x (24-100mm) focal length may not deliver the big bad zoom of the P510, and it can't do RAW like the P7100, but it compensates with some serious optical features instead. Among them is improved image stabilization, which Nikon says will let you take blur-free handheld shots at four stops below what would otherwise be possible. There's also a "market leading" f/1.8 maximum aperture, which further aid low-light shooting as well shallow depth-of-field shots. Finally, the form factor is really important. This camera is a lot smaller than either the P510 or the P7100 and it feels great in the hand: not quite pocketable, perhaps, but certainly portable, discreet and sturdy.     A Silicon Valley start-up called Lytro claims it's working on a consumer camera that uses light field technology to radically change the way we take, edit and experience photographs. Whereas a normal digital camera captures a snapshot of light hitting a sensor, a light field camera first separates rays of light in order to individually record their color, intensity and direction. This extra information opens up a world of possibilities, including the ability to focus on any depth of field within a taken photo, observe a 3D-type effect even without specs, and boost images taken in extremely low light. Although light field cameras have been around for some time, they haven't been commercially viable. Now though, Lytro has secured backing worth $50million to bring a "competitively priced" camera to market "later this year" -- we'll see if they can beat similar plenoptic technology from Adobe to market.     You might know them for seemingly ridiculous innovations like Segway shoes or the HRP-4C pop star robot, but the folks at AIST have put away the gimmicks for their latest invention -- a full-color night vision camera. Produced by Nanolux, an arm of AIST, the camera uses a series of algorithms to read and process wavelengths reflected by objects lit with infrareds, allowing it to successfully reproduce reds, blues, and greens in the darkest of conditions. The company hopes to make the device available by the end of 2011 at a price point lower than conventional night vision cameras, and says they will work with different lenses to improve long-range photography for the device. Such an invention could have serious implications for fields like surveillance and wildlife observation, but fear not, AIST hasn't lost its sense of humor -- the company used a Bullwinkle figurine rotating on a Lazy Susan to demo its latest invention at Printable Electronics 2011.     Did you ever think that you'd see a CMOS sensor measuring 202 x 205 mm? That's 7.95 x 8.07 inches to our fine imperial friends. Its impressive size -- about 40 times larger than Canon's largest commercial CMOS sensor -- translates to staggering light-gathering capabilities, capturing images in one one-hundredth the amount of light required by a professional DSLR. Better yet, the sensor is matched by new circuitry allowing for video capture at 60fps in just 0.3 lux of illumination (think full moon on a clear night).     We already knew that Kodak was up to something good when it began to phase out low-end digicams and refocus on developing new technologies, and now it seems like we've got one more innovation from its laboratory to look forward to. Reportedly, Kodak has developed a "color-filter technology that at least doubles the sensitivity to light of the image sensor in every digital camera." Bold words, we know, but even Chris McNiffe, general manager of the photography company's image sensor business, went so far as to say that this very invention would enable a "2x-4x improvement in light sensitivity." The company also suggested that a variety of camera manufacturers could expect samples of said technology during the first quarter of next year, and while consumer rollouts weren't detailed, we do know that this magical concoction will hit P&S cameras first with cameraphones to get equipped shortly thereafter.
